| AN ACT |
| |
1 | Designating the bridge that carries Pennsylvania Turnpike Route |
2 | 43 over the Monongahela River between Denbo in the Borough of |
3 | Centerville, County of Washington, and Alicia in the Township |
4 | of Luzerne, County of Fayette, as the PFC Ronald C. "Smokey" |
5 | Bakewell Memorial Bridge. |
6 | The General Assembly of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ania |
7 | hereby enacts as follows: |
8 | Section 1. PFC Ronald C. "Smokey" Bakewell Memorial Bridge. |
9 | (a) Declaration.--The General Assembly declares that Private |
10 | First Class Ronald C. "Smokey" Bakewell made the ultimate |
11 | sacrifice for this Commonwealth on August 2, 1968, when he died |
12 | from hostile, small arms fire while serving in the Army of the |
13 | United States in South Vietnam. On June 16, 1968, PFC Bakewell, |
14 | age 20, was assigned to C Company, 1st Battalion, 5th Cavalry, |
15 | 1st Air Cavalry Division, when less than two months later his |
16 | life ended in the service of his country. |
17 | (b) Designation.--The bridge that carries Pennsylvania |
18 | Turnpike Route 43 over the Monongahela River between Denbo in |
19 | the Borough of Centerville, County of Washington, and Alicia in |
|
1 | the Township of Luzerne, County of Fayette, is designated the |
2 | PFC Ronald C. "Smokey" Bakewell Memorial Bridge. |
3 | (c) Signs.--The Pennsylvania Turnpike Commission shall place |
4 | and maintain appropriate signs at both ends of the bridge as |
5 | designated in subsection (b). |
6 | Section 2. Effective date. |
7 | This act shall take effect in 60 days. |
